
BREAKING NEWS: 5-Star Cornerback Devin Sanchez Commits to Notre Dame, Shocking the College Football Landscape
In a monumental shift in the college football recruiting landscape, 5-star cornerback Devin Sanchez has officially committed to the University of Notre Dame, shocking both fans and analysts alike. The announcement, which was made earlier today, has sent waves of excitement through the Fighting Irish fanbase and the broader college football community. Sanchez, who is regarded as one of the top defensive prospects in the 2026 class, was heavily pursued by several powerhouse programs, making his commitment to Notre Dame all the more surprising.
The 6-foot-1, 190-pound Sanchez, hailing from Houston, Texas, is widely considered one of the most elite cornerbacks in the country. His combination of size, speed, and ball-hawking ability has drawn comparisons to some of the best in the game. With a remarkable high school career that has seen him rack up numerous interceptions, forced fumbles, and pass breakups, Sanchez has proven to be a lockdown defender capable of shutting down some of the most dynamic wide receivers in the nation.
Sanchez’s commitment to Notre Dame marks a pivotal moment in the program’s recruitment strategy, as the Fighting Irish have historically been known for their strong defenses. The addition of such a highly-ranked cornerback will only bolster an already impressive defensive unit under head coach Marcus Freeman. Freeman, who has transformed the Notre Dame defense into one of the best in the country, will now have one of the nation’s most talented defensive backs to build his secondary around.
